table manners
英 [ˈteɪbl mænəz]
美 [ˈteɪbl mænərz]
n. 餐桌规矩; 进餐礼节
牛津词典
noun
- 餐桌规矩;进餐礼节
the behaviour that is considered correct while you are having a meal at a table with other people
柯林斯词典
- N-PLURAL 餐桌礼仪;用餐规矩
You can usetable mannersto refer to the way you behave when you are eating a meal at a table.- He attacked the food as quickly as decent table manners allowed.
他在不失礼的情况下尽可能快地进餐。
- He attacked the food as quickly as decent table manners allowed.
